Must-Have Food Heating Devices for Every Event

While catered functions differ in scale and design, possessing reliable food warmers is essential for ensuring that meals are presented at the optimal temperature. Food warmers come in various forms, including chafing units, electric warming appliances, and heating lamps, each created to maintain meal standards while meeting different catering requirements.

Chafing dishes rank among the most popular for their range of uses and enduring style, allowing both presentational beauty and proficient warming. Electric food warmers afford ease, notably in buffet-style setups, as they can be adjusted to hold specific temperatures. Heat lamps, in contrast, furnish an streamlined method to preserve the warmth of plated dishes without overcooking.

In the end, the right food warmers not only enhance the dining experience but also promote food safety, guaranteeing that all dishes remain at safe serving temperatures throughout the event. Putting money in quality warmers is critical for any caterer aiming for success.

Secure Cooling Options

Five secure refrigeration options emerge as essential storage solutions for caterers. First, upright reach-in refrigerators provide convenient access to food items while maximizing floor space. Second, undercounter cooling units maintain commonly accessed products close at hand, enhancing workflow productivity. Third, walk-in coolers provide substantial capacity for bulk volumes, making them perfect for high-volume catering events. Fourth, mobile cooling units are essential for remote catering assignments, enabling refrigerated transportation of food products. Finally, rapid freezing units rapidly cool down cooked foods, preserving freshness and quality. Each of these cooling solutions ensures that catering businesses copyright food health regulations, control inventory effectively, and streamline operations, ultimately supporting the growth of their catering business.
